Rendering Baked GI in Unity 5 happens in two phases. The Precompute and the Bake. The Precompute phase happens with both Realtime GI and Baked GI, but the Bake phase only happens with Baked GI. The only way to see the complete render time is to open the Unity Editor log file and look for both the Bake time and the…

My guess your issue is with 2d patterns like procedural brick texture because 3d noises look same from any view directions. For 2d patterns a common way is to use so called tri-planar projection. Blender doesn't have it by default but it's either possible to find on blenderartist.org or do it on your own: You make 3…

Maya's default unit should correspond to Unity's default meter units. If you make something 2 units tall it should import nicely to be 2m in Unity. Very handy. As for what to set your grid to, (Display > Grid > [ ]) that's up to you, and it depends on what you're working on. You have 3 basic options: Length and Width -…
